In our experience, most homeowners respond quickly to a bang or a screeching sound from the furnace, but not to a humming noise, because it may start quietly and still seem like the system is running.
A light hum can be normal on some systems, especially when electrical components are energized, or the blower is moving air through the house.
But a new, louder, or constant humming sound usually means something inside the furnace is struggling. It may be a blower motor, capacitor, transformer, inducer motor, clogged filter, loose part, or another electrical or airflow issue.

When to Shut the Furnace Off Right Away
Most humming furnaces are not an emergency, but a few symptoms are. Turn the thermostat off, then switch off the furnace breaker at your electrical panel if you notice any of the following.
- The furnace hums, but no air comes from the vents. A motor that sits and hums without turning draws heavy current and heats up fast. Left running, it can burn out a repairable part.
- You smell burning plastic or hot metal. This points to overheating wiring or a failing electrical component.
- The breaker trips, or lights flicker when the furnace starts. Either one suggests an electrical fault that needs to remain de-energized until a technician inspects it.
- You see a swollen, leaking, or scorched component through a vent opening. Do not open the cabinet to look closer.
If you smell gas, treat it as a serious hazard. Do not touch the thermostat, the breaker, or any light switch. Leave the house, then call your gas provider or 911 from outside.
If none of these apply and the furnace is still heating the house, you have time to work through the sound.
What the Furnace Humming Sound Is Telling You
A hum that shows up before the burners light points somewhere very different from a hum that never stops, even when the system is idle.
Match your situation to the closest description below, then read the matching cause further down.
- The furnace hums, but no air moves through the vents. The blower motor is trying to start and failing. This is usually a bad capacitor or a failing motor. See causes 4 and 5.
- The hum starts before any warm air arrives, then the furnace shuts down. The inducer motor runs first in the startup sequence, so a hum at this stage often traces back to it or to a venting restriction. See cause 7.
- The hum occurs only while the burners are lit and stops the moment they are cut off. This pattern points to the gas valve. See cause 9.
- The hum continues even when the furnace is not heating. Something stays energized when it should not. This is typically the transformer, a relay, or the control board. See causes 8 and 10.
- The sound is more of a vibration and changes when you press on the cabinet or nearby duct. A loose panel, screw, or duct section is resonating while the blower runs. See cause 3.
- The hum sounds strained, and the airflow feels weak. The blower is working against a restriction. Start with the filter and vents. See causes 1 and 2.
If the sound does not fit cleanly into any of these, work through the causes in order. The first three are safe to check yourself, and ruling them out gives a technician a faster starting point.

1. A Clogged Air Filter Is Making the Blower Work Harder
The air filter is one of the first things to check when a furnace starts humming.
Your furnace needs steady airflow to move warm air through the house, and when the filter is packed with dust, pet hair, and debris, the blower has to work harder to pull air through the system.
That extra strain can show up as a low humming sound from the blower area, often accompanied by weak airflow, longer heating cycles, or a furnace that shuts off sooner than expected due to overheating.
Turn the system off, remove the filter, and hold it up to a light. If you cannot see through it, replace it. Make sure the new filter is the right size, installed in the correct direction, and not too restrictive for your system. A high-efficiency filter that chokes airflow can create the same strain as a dirty one.
Run the furnace again and listen. If the humming fades and the airflow improves, the filter was the problem. If the furnace still hums, or the blower sounds like it is struggling to start, the issue is deeper in the system.
2. Closed or Blocked Vents Are Restricting Airflow
A furnace can also sound strained when the airflow problem lies outside the furnace rather than inside it. If too many supply vents are closed, blocked by furniture, or covered by rugs or curtains, the blower has to push against extra pressure in the ductwork.
Blocked return vents cause the same trouble from the other direction. Your furnace needs a clear path for air to return to the system, and when that path is restricted, the blower may hum louder while the house still feels uncomfortable.
Walk through the home and make sure the supply registers are open and clear. Then check the return vents for furniture, storage bins, curtains, or pet beds.
If the humming improves, the furnace was reacting to restricted airflow. If the sound persists with weak airflow throughout the house, the problem may be in the blower, ductwork, or another internal component.
3. A Loose Furnace Panel or Vibrating Ductwork
Sometimes the furnace is running normally, but a loose access panel, screw, bracket, or nearby section of ductwork vibrates while the blower is on. That vibration can sound like a steady hum or low buzz.
This kind of noise is usually more noticeable when the blower starts moving air. It may come from the furnace cabinet, the return duct, or a metal panel near the system. In some cases, the sound changes if you gently press on the outside of the panel or nearby ductwork.
You can check that the furnace access panel is seated correctly and that nothing is leaning against the unit. If a visible panel screw is loose, tightening it may stop the vibration. Do not remove the panel while the system is running, and do not reach inside the furnace cabinet.
If the hum sounds like it is coming from inside the furnace, or if tightening the outside panel does not help, have a technician inspect it. A loose internal part can get worse over time and may eventually damage the blower assembly or other components.
4. A Bad Capacitor Is Preventing a Motor From Starting
One of the more common causes of a loud furnace hum is a motor that tries to start but fails. On systems that use a capacitor, that small electrical part gives the motor the boost it needs to get moving.
When the capacitor weakens or fails, the motor may sit there and hum instead of starting. The motor draws heavy current the whole time it sits stalled, which is why this particular hum needs a fast response.
Variable-speed blowers start differently and do not use a start capacitor, so a humming variable-speed system points toward the motor’s control module instead.
This often sounds different from a normal operating hum. You may hear the furnace call for heat, then hear a steady humming or buzzing sound, but the blower does not come on. In some cases, the system may shut itself down, or the breaker may trip.
Do not try to replace or test a capacitor yourself. Capacitors are electrical components, and the problem can also be tied to the motor, wiring, relay, or control board. A technician can test the capacitor safely and confirm whether it is the real cause before replacing anything.
If your furnace is humming but the blower will not start, turn the system off and call for service. A motor that sits and hums without starting will overheat, and that turns a smaller repair into a more expensive one.
5. The Blower Motor Is Struggling or Failing
The blower motor moves heated air through your ductwork and into your home’s rooms. When that motor starts to fail, humming is one of the sounds homeowners may notice before the furnace system stops working completely.
A failing blower motor may hum, buzz, grind, or make a strained sound while the furnace runs. You may also feel weak airflow from every vent, notice that the furnace runs longer than usual, or hear the blower try to start and then stop.
Sometimes the motor itself is the problem. Other times, the issue is a weak capacitor, loose wiring, a dirty blower wheel, a worn bearing, a relay problem, or an incorrect fan speed setting. Since all of those problems can produce similar symptoms, this is not something to guess at.

6. A Dirty or Loose Blower Wheel
Even when the blower motor is still working, the blower wheel can create noise if it is dirty, loose, or out of balance. Over time, dust and debris can build up on the wheel blades. That extra weight can make the wheel spin unevenly, which may create a humming, vibrating, or low-rumbling sound.
A dirty blower wheel can also reduce airflow. That means the furnace may sound like it is running, but the air coming from the vents feels weaker than it should. You may notice more dust in the home, longer heating cycles, or uneven heating from room to room.
This is different from changing a filter. The blower wheel sits inside the furnace cabinet, and cleaning it usually requires removing parts, protecting electrical components, and making sure the wheel is reinstalled correctly.
If the furnace hums while air is moving, and the filter and vents are not the issue, the blower wheel should be inspected. A technician can clean it, tighten it, check the motor shaft, and make sure the blower assembly is balanced and moving air properly.
7. The Inducer Motor Is Humming Before the Furnace Ignites
If the humming starts before warm air ever comes from the vents, the issue may be near the inducer motor. The inducer motor helps move combustion gases through the heat exchanger and out through the venting system before the burners ignite.
When the inducer motor starts to fail, gets stuck, or has worn bearings, it may hum or buzz instead of spinning correctly. You may hear the furnace try to start, hum for a while, and then shut down without producing heat.
A venting restriction can sometimes create a similar problem. Leaves, pollen buildup, debris, or animal nests around the exterior furnace vent can interfere with the system’s startup sequence.
You can safely check the outdoor intake and exhaust pipes if they are accessible. Make sure they are not blocked by debris, plants, or stored items. Do not take apart the inducer assembly or venting inside the furnace.
If the furnace hums before ignition and never begins heating, shut it off and call a technician. The inducer motor, pressure switch, venting, and ignition sequence must work together for safe operation.
8. A Transformer or Electrical Component Is Buzzing
The concern with an electrical hum is when it becomes louder, sharper, constant, or new. A louder electrical buzz can indicate a loose transformer, a failing relay, a control board issue, loose wiring, or another electrical component not operating correctly.
You may also notice other symptoms with this kind of problem, such as the furnace not responding to the thermostat, short cycling, intermittent operation, or the blower running when it should not.
Electrical issues are not safe to troubleshoot by opening the furnace and looking around. If the hum sounds electrical or continues when the furnace is not actively heating, turn the system off and schedule service.
A technician can trace the source of the sound, test the components, and repair the issue without risking damage to the furnace or your home’s wiring.
9. The Gas Valve Is Humming
A gas furnace may produce a brief, low hum when the gas valve is energized, but a loud or constant humming sound from the gas valve area should not be ignored. The gas valve controls the flow of gas to the burners, so any unusual sound from that part of the system needs professional attention.
This problem may show up when the furnace tries to ignite. You might hear a hum or buzz, but the burners do not light, the system shuts down, or the furnace keeps trying to restart. In some cases, the issue may be the gas valve itself. In others, it may be tied to the ignition system, control board, or wiring.
Do not try to adjust, clean, or repair a gas valve yourself. If you smell gas, leave the home and call your gas company or emergency services from a safe location.
If there is no gas smell but the furnace is humming near the burner or gas valve area and not heating properly, turn the system off and call an HVAC technician. Gas and ignition problems need to be diagnosed carefully.
10. A Control Board or Relay Is Stuck
The control board is the part that coordinates the furnace’s startup and shutdown sequence. It tells the inducer, ignitor, gas valve, blower, and safety switches when to operate. If a relay sticks or the control board begins to fail, the furnace may hum, buzz, run at the wrong time, or fail to complete a heating cycle.
This can be tricky for homeowners because the furnace may still work sometimes. It may hum after the heat cycle ends, start and stop randomly, leave the blower running too long, or refuse to turn on even though the thermostat is calling for heat.
A control issue can look like a thermostat, motor, or ignition problem, so it needs proper testing. Replacing parts without diagnosing the sequence can lead to unnecessary repairs.

Furnace Still Humming?
A humming furnace is not always an emergency, but it is a warning sign worth paying attention to.
If the sound is light and the system is still heating, the cause may be something simple, such as a dirty filter, a blocked vent, a loose panel, or an airflow restriction. But if the humming is loud, new, constant, or paired with no heat, weak airflow, a burning smell, a tripped breaker, or a system that will not start, the problem is likely deeper inside the furnace.
That is when you should have the system checked. Furnace humming can come from electrical parts, motors, capacitors, the inducer assembly, the gas valve, or the control board, and those are not parts homeowners should try to repair on their own.
